Ein renommiertes Restaurant für die Köstlichkeiten von Dashi
Dashi und Reis MUKU ARASHIYAMA ist ein auf Dashi und frisch gekochten Reis spezialisiertes japanisches Restaurant. Die sorgfältig aus Kombu und Bonito zubereiteten Dashi-Gerichte werden in Form von Menüs serviert, sodass man die Umami der Zutaten in vollen Zügen genießen kann. Der in einem Hahnenkamm gekochte Koshihikari-Reis aus Kyoto ist ebenfalls exquisit und bietet die Möglichkeit, einen luxuriösen Morgen zu verbringen.

A renowned restaurant for enjoying the beauty of Kyoto through shojin cuisine
Shigetsu is a shojin cuisine restaurant located near the gardens of Tenryuji Temple in Arashiyama, where you can enjoy the beauty of the seasons. The dishes, made with carefully selected Kyoto vegetables and wild plants, are characterized by their vibrant colors and delicate flavors. Dining in a tatami-matted room allows you to enjoy your meal in a comfortable Japanese atmosphere, providing a soothing experience for both the mind and body. A restaurant where you can enjoy thick-cut sushi in a homey atmosphere
Sushi Iso is a beloved sushi restaurant in the Arashiyama area, cherished by locals. The interior has a warm, homey vibe, and they take pride in their thick-cut, incredibly fresh sushi toppings. The buri kama (yellowtail collar) is particularly rich and delicious. Enjoying sushi alongside a wide selection of sake offers an exceptional dining experience.

A specialty shop for authentic milk tea and scones
CHAVATY Kyoto Arashiyama is a specialty shop that offers an authentic taste of milk tea and scones. You can enjoy milk tea made with Uva tea leaves from Sri Lanka, one of the world's three great teas, as well as milk tea made with Japanese matcha and hojicha. The interior is new and stylish, making it the perfect space to stop by while exploring Arashiyama. The scones, in particular, have a wonderful freshly baked texture and are irresistibly delicious.
